Rehab unit underway at Southern Hills

Work to build the 12-bed inpatient rehabilitation unit pitched by Southern Hills Medical Center last March is now underway. The TriStar Health System hospital expects the facility to open on June 1.
“Our Rehab Center will treat patients with neurologic, orthopaedic, trauma, stroke, cardiac and cancer disabilities,” explained Thomas Ozburn, Chief Executive Officer of the hospital. “Our team is very excited to be able to offer this much needed service to Nashvillians and people in the surrounding cities.”
The 132-bed hospital serves southern Davidson, northern Rutherford and Wilson Counties.
